Blackened tilapia with black beans and chile-lime salsa over brown rice | Sunbasket
This surfside dish takes us back to Baja, California. We season fresh fish with chili powder, sweet smoked paprika, and a little bit of Mexican oregano, then serve it over zesty cilantro-lime rice...
Ingredients
- ½ cup quick-cooking long-grain brown rice
- 1 organic red onion
- 1 13.4 ounce carton cooked black beans
- Sunbasket chile-lime salsa (tomatillos - lime juice - dried New Mexican chiles - garlic - kosher salt)
- Seafood options:
- 2 sustainably raised skinless tilapia fillets (about 5½ ounces each)
- 2 sustainably raised Chilean skin-on salmon fillets (about 5 ounces each)
- 10 ounces wild jumbo shrimp
- Sunbasket Tex-Mex seasoning blend (chili powder - onion powder - granulated garlic - sweet smoked paprika - dried Mexican oregano)
- 1 organic lime
